Discover the beautiful surroundings of Bucharest and visit two of the most important and interesting sites: Mogosoaia Palace, an over 300 year old palace located in a charming and very large park and Snagov Monastery, which became famous thanks to the Legend of Dracula as, according to local stories, it is believed that in the monastery, Vlad the Impaler has his grave.

At a Glance

The experience, in brief

  • Mogosoaia Palace is a historical monument built in the 17th century by Prince Constantin Brâncoveanu in a unique Romanian Renaissance style, surrounded by a beautiful garden and a lake.
  • Snagov Monastery is a medieval monastery and historical monument located on an island in Lake Snagov, where some legends say Vlad the Impaler, the inspiration for Dracula, is buried.
